The Background 


Based on Triumphs modern incarnation of a classic sixties speedster, the Bonneville T100, this rare one of 50 Paul Smith multi-Union versions is a modern and chic motorcycle that stands out from the crowd. This version got a few special one off additions, these include the painted badge, the tank, side panels and the pinstriped mudguards.

Fundamentally a T100 it has the 865cc air cooled parallel twin engine twined to a five-speed gearbox. With around 61hp this bike shifts you down the road at some rate of knots, doing this effortlessly and with great style.

The History 


Being such a special bike you can imagine that this Bonneville has had a special story. Built in around 2005 this bike was a special collaboration between the high-end designer Paul Smith and the infamous Triumph motorcycle company. Benefitting from a unique union flag design on the fuel tank and other little touches this bike now stands out from the crowd.

This specific bike was used as the press bike to promote this collaboration and as such is the one you will see in all the press pictures from the time. From the studio it went on a tour of UK Triumph dealers and ultimately ended up in the window of Harrods, where this bike was put up as a raffle prize.

The current owner saw the bike in the automotive section of the Daily Mail and set about trying to procure one. They become the second person to put a deposit down, it would later transpire that Triumph had somehow over sold the allocation. As a peacekeeping mission Triumph offered up this raffle bike from Harrods to the current owner and they accepted.

Taking delivery in 2006 this bike has since been dry stored and left as it was delivered with only half a mile on the odometer. It has never been ridden or registered on UK roads and only a handful of people know of its existence.

The Paperwork 


Because this bike has never been on the roads there is no V5 but you do get the application form to register the bike. Due to this bikes stored life there aren’t many items of paperwork like MOT certificates, Service receipts or any other type of Invoice. This however is expected because of its life.

What you do get with the bike is a comprehensive Motorcycle service manual, the original owners handbook. As you would imagine there are no service stamps in the service book, but this is obviously due to the fact that this bike has never seen the road.

A few other items of paperwork that come with the bike include newspaper clippings about this bike, a few pieces of correspondence between the current owner and the Triumph dealer where this bike came from and it also has the original bill of sale.

You will also get little bits of memorabilia that came with the bike when the current owner obtained it all those years ago. These include a laptop/document bag, Triumph Riders Association keyring and other little bits.

The condition


This bike is a truly stunning looking bike, designed initially by triumph as a retro throwback to their classic bikes of old Paul Smith was then tasked to give a bit of noughties pizzazz and this is exactly what he achieved. This bike is the ‘multi-union’ version this one came with a special painted Union Flag on the fuel tanks, side panels and mudguards. With these bespoke edition this bike it will now stand out in a collection of other motorcycles.

With this bike having been dry stored for practically its whole life you are correct in thinking that everything from the special painted Triumph badge to the chrome engine covers are in excellent condition. There are no marks on the bike at all and everything is in ‘as delivered’ condition.
If you look under the pinstriped mudguards there are tell tale signs that this bike has genuinely never been near a UK road and as a result it is presented in pristine condition.

The original Yuasa battery comes with the bike within its original cardboard packaging and hasn’t been in place for some time, if you look at the battery box under the seat it is immaculate. There are also the two chromed mirrors that the current owner has never fitted due to the bikes life in storage.

Overall every single of the bespoke and factory features of this bike are presented in immaculate condition with the brightwork being stunning, no marks on the paint, no wear of the handlebars or seat. This is quite possibly one of the cleanest bikes up for sale.

The Mechanics 


This Paul Smith limited edition bike is based on Triumphs now famous Bonneville T100 model, so all of the underpinnings are the same as this.

Because this bike is still in delivery condition it hasn’t ever been started or ridden so if the new owner decides they want to do this they will need to get a specialist in the make sure that everything is lubricated properly and then subsequently it will need to go through its running in period.

Due to its lack of running or having any fluids near it you can imagine that the engine looks immaculate and clean. With it being dry stored too you shouldn’t have to worry about any potential surprises that you may find if the bike hasn’t been stored properly.
